hey guys, well, hmmm....

ill focus on the deliciosa for now and at least compare them. perhaps if we go thru popow again ill post a review on the proper sub.

so one of them obviously has spikes, and it’s clear it has flowered at least once before. after really close inspection the other has not appeared to have flowered yet. the leaves on the one in flower are at least a couple cm’s longer than the other, tho i haven’t measured or averaged, but its pretty clear. my best guess is that one was in the center/bright location and one was growing off to the side or something. and at this point i am assuming they are actually the same species.

for those who have gone thru popow before, is it normal to not include id tags? anywho....

so i want to take one for s/h and was thinking of mounting the other or just putting it in regular mix. might leave the one with spikes till it’s done flowering, but not sure yet....

they seem pretty healthy, so i don’t wanna be to down on them just yet! hahahah, but i need to get some cork or something if i wanna mount one, so hopefully can settle in a bit first
